Output 3d31e83ccfa1fc331669789de120ba26ea15d6b81554b4a042513f079d5f0637:1

value
1205278
script pubkey
OP_0 OP_PUSHBYTES_20 74a44394e8cd51f29d22589fbd9a1fa7b618ee4a
address
ltc1qwjjy898ge4gl98fztz0mmxsl57mp3mj2chx64a
transaction
3d31e83ccfa1fc331669789de120ba26ea15d6b81554b4a042513f079d5f0637
spent
true